Did you know that Washington has 10 Vocational Skills Centers throughout the state?
Vocational Skills Centers (part of Career and Technical Education) prepare students for high school demand, high wage jobs through applied learning classes. Students learn technical skills associated with the career, participate in industry sponsored internships and job shadows, with an emphasis on employability and job readiness.
Skills Centers are operated in collaboration with multiple area school districts and classes are on a block schedule. Students remain enrolled in their home high school where they complement their skill center class with academic coursework appropriate to their area of interest.
